Network Engineer

1 month ago


Newport News, United States Liebherr Full time

The primary focus of this position is to provide networking, LAN/WAN support and data center management, responding to requests such as help desk tickets, telephone, email and in-person service within the Liebherr Groups and its Newport News VA location as well as other state side locations in accordance with Liebherr International IT security standards. This includes troubleshooting hardware and software related issues.

Responsibilities

  • Leads a team of network professionals, manages timely execution and completion of tasks, and provides regular reporting to management.
  • Implements and supports Cisco LAN/WAN/ & wireless networks, VOIP systems, AV Conferencing equipment and related computing environments including hardware, software and their respective configurations at local and remote Liebherr facilities.
  • Diagnoses, troubleshoots, and resolves hardware, software, wiring, or other network and system problems, and replace defective and outdated components as necessary.
  • Creates and keeps documentation updated related to new and existing IT infrastructure.
  • Manages all aspects of network licensing, maintenance renewals, and service contracts.
  • Plans, coordinates, and implements network security measures to protect data, software, and hardware (VLAN's, access control lists, etc.).
  • Manages accounts, network rights, and access to devices and equipment.
  • Maintains network devices to function in a virtualized environment with VxRail/VMware vSphere/vCenter, Hyper-V and SAN environment (Cisco, NetApp, Dell).
  • Manages the replacement of network infrastructure in local and remote Liebherr locations.
  • Implements/Manages Cisco DNA Center, SDA/ACI, and ISE.
  • Manages telecommunication and provider provisioning (DIA, MPLS, PRI, POTS etc.) for local and remote sites.
  • Performs data center management tasks and assists in the design of datacenters.
  • Installs, configures, and maintains local and remote firewalls, storage appliances, battery backup technologies, and environmental monitoring controls.
  • Performs accurate configuration backups of devices and ensure recovery from component failures.
  • Installs, configures, and operates network management products to monitor and maintain network equipment and computer systems.
  • Maintains logs related to network performance, as well as maintenance and repair records.
  • Maintains accurate asset information and inventory, while adhering to asset management policies.
  • Meets financial requirements by submitting information for budgets and monitoring expenses.
  • Provides network related guidance and training to end users and IT staff.
  • Recommends changes to improve systems and network configurations. Determines hardware or software requirements related to such changes.
  • Stays informed of current technology, trends and best practices related to networking and computer systems. Analyzes and recommends changes and upgrades to staff and IT management.
  • Gathers data pertaining to customer needs, and uses the information to identify, predict, interpret, and evaluate system and network requirements.
  • Coordinates with vendors and with company personnel to facilitate equipment purchases.
  • Handles support requests via help desk tickets, phone, and email or in person.
  • Protects organization's value by keeping information confidential.
  • Practices 5S methodology to keep responsible areas organized and always maintained.
  • Monitors network bandwidth usage at all sites and plans for bandwidth upgrades as necessary.
Competencies

  • Education and Experience:
    •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Systems or related discipline with a minimum of 4 years of related network administration experience, or an Associates deg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Systems or related discipline with a minimum of 6 years of related network administration experience, or a minimum of 8 years of related network administration experience in lieu of a degree. CCNP certification can be accepted in lieu of degree requirement.
    • A minimum of 3 years in a technical lead position, successfully leading technical personnel and managing related tasks.
    • Current CCNP, CCIE Certification, or equivalent is strongly preferred.
    • Security+ or equivalent certification is strongly preferred.
    • Experience in migrating environments to Cisco DNA, SDA, ISE/ACI is strongly preferred.
    • Experience with Virtualization Technologies (VMware) is preferred.
  • Strong leadership and task management experience in an environment with multiple ongoing and demanding projects.
  • Strong experience in installing and troubleshooting local and remote WAN and LAN network equipment including DIA and MPLS WAN circuits, routing (BGP/EIGRP/OSPF), VLANs, VPN tunnels, encryption, RSA keys and switchport configurations.
  • Strong experience in managing Cisco equipment, including routers, switches, firewalls, wireless controllers and access points, IP phones, call manager and conferencing systems.
  • Strong experience in designing and building local and remote networks, including the specification and procurement of telco circuits with providers.
  • Strong experience in supporting virtualized environments such as VMware vSphere/vCenter, and SAN equipment (Cisco, NetApp, Dell).
  • Strong experience in managing and updating IT related network and datacenter hardware (Cisco, Palo Alto, Dell, APC, Tripp-Lite, Vertiv).
  • Strong experience in managing Network Policy Servers (NPS) and Radius authentication.
  • Strong experience in creating and updating network and systems documentation using tools such as MS-Word, MS-Excel, MS-Visio, Atlassian Confluence and Draw.io.
  • Experience with procuring network equipment and license management.
  • Experience with building and maintaining access control, camera/NVR, and security systems.
  • Experience with SolarWinds products (NPM, SAM, NCM, UDT, NTA)
  • Strong troubleshooting and research capabilities (including Internet, documentation, reaching out to peers and external partners).
  • Excellent people and interpersonal skills. Is competent and comfortable with handling support requests via help desk tickets, phone, and email or in person.
  • Ability to multi-task and work with minimal supervision.
  • Demonstrated ability to make decisions; support and explain reasoning for decisions; include appropriate people in decision-making process.
  • Demonstrate ability to meet set goals.
  • Solid verbal and written communication skills, ability to communicate technical concepts to techn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Analytical and problem-solving abilities with keen attention to detail; demonstrates accuracy and thoroughness, looks for ways to improve and promote quality.
  • Ability to work independently as well as in a team environment.
  • Experience using help desk software and ability to coordinate with other help desk personnel for successful and timely resolution of tickets.
  • Experience using remote connection tools and help desk software.
  • Travel domestically and internationally up to 15% of the time.
  • Current valid driver's license and passport with the ability to maintain them.
  • Available for on-call work as needed.
  • Ability to complete and maintain mine certifications or safety training such as Mine Safety and Health Administration (MSHA) hazard training.

The company

In line with its international growth, Liebherr's venture into the United States began in 1970. Within a couple of years, the company expanded and completed its production facilities in Newport News, Virginia, for its product line of hydraulic excavators. It was later converted into Liebherr's manufacturing facility for mining trucks and remains home to Liebherr Mining Equipment Newport News, Co. In addition to its production facility, Liebherr markets a wide variety of products and technologies through its companies located across the United States. The companies are Liebherr-Aerospace Saline, Inc., Liebherr Gear Technology, Inc., Liebherr Automation Systems, Co., and Liebherr USA, Co., the umbrella company for 12 product segments that are positioned across the United States.
